Understanding how to measure body fat at home

Home body-fat methods estimate rather than directly measure fat mass, and repeatability is often more useful than the displayed precision.

In this article, how to measure body fat at home is used within a wider definition: every practical method is an estimate: skinfolds, bioelectrical-impedance scales, circumference equations, air displacement, and imaging use different assumptions and can produce different results.

Bioelectrical-impedance scales are affected by hydration, food, exercise, skin temperature, and device equations.

Factors That Change the Answer

Personal interpretation of how to measure body fat at home should account for this context: body-composition estimates change with the method, hydration, recent food and exercise, age, sex, and the equation used by the device.

The individual factors for how to measure body fat at home also include the following: body-fat goals should account for age, sex, training demands, menstrual or hormonal function, medical history, and the reason for measuring.

When to Seek Qualified Help

Individual advice about how to measure body fat at home is especially important in these situations: get individual advice when weight or composition changes unexpectedly, when restrictive eating is developing, or when a medical condition affects safe nutrition or exercise.

A separate safety boundary also applies to how to measure body fat at home: stop and seek qualified advice if the pursuit of a body-fat target causes dizziness, recurrent injury, missed periods, loss of libido, persistent fatigue, compulsive checking, bingeing, purging, or severe food restriction.

Home body-fat methods estimate rather than directly measure fat mass, and repeatability is often more useful than the displayed precision. Body composition separates total weight into components such as fat mass and fat-free mass. Every practical method is an estimate: skinfolds, bioelectrical-impedance scales, circumference equations, air displacement, and imaging use different assumptions and can produce different results.
Body-composition estimates change with the method, hydration, recent food and exercise, age, sex, and the equation used by the device. Body-fat goals should account for age, sex, training demands, menstrual or hormonal function, medical history, and the reason for measuring. A lower percentage is not automatically healthier, and a single reference chart cannot define the best level for every person.
Select one method and learn its instructions. Measure at a similar time under similar hydration, meal, and exercise conditions. When fat loss is appropriate, combine a moderate energy deficit with progressive resistance training, adequate protein, varied food, sleep, and recovery. That approach is more protective of lean tissue and performance than rapid restriction or large volumes of compensatory exercise.
Do not compare values from different devices as if they share the same scale. Do not use a home estimate to diagnose a disease or justify extreme restriction. Home devices cannot identify exactly where fat is stored or diagnose metabolic disease. Comparisons are also misleading when one reading comes from a home scale and another comes from a different equation, scanner, or testing protocol.
Get individual advice when weight or composition changes unexpectedly, when restrictive eating is developing, or when a medical condition affects safe nutrition or exercise. Stop and seek qualified advice if the pursuit of a body-fat target causes dizziness, recurrent injury, missed periods, loss of libido, persistent fatigue, compulsive checking, bingeing, purging, or severe food restriction.
